site stats

Clk in testbench verilog

WebMarch 25, 2016 at 6:16 PM. Reg: interpreting @ posedge clk in verilog testbench from HW point of view ... hi, ive read and observed on actual hardware that the data/control lines … WebApr 14, 2024 · 你好!下面是一个使用 Verilog 写的 60 进制计数器的示例代码。这个计数器有四个输入: 1. `clock`:时钟信号。2. `reset`:当设为高电平时,计数器会重置为 0 …

Verilog Testbench - wait for specific number of clock cycle edges

WebThis will bump up the clock period to 1.563 which actually represents 639795 kHz ! The following Verilog clock generator module has three parameters to tweak the three … WebApr 11, 2024 · 基于vivado(语言Verilog)的FPGA学习(5)——跨时钟处理. 1. 为什么要解决跨时钟处理问题. 慢时钟到快时钟一般都不需要处理,关键需要解决从快时钟到慢时钟的问题,因为可能会漏信号或者失真,比如:. hornungs linglestown https://elmobley.com

Layered Testbench for Viterbi Decoder Verification Academy

WebAnswer the following questions about Verilog coding. (a) Verilog code of a testbench is given below. First, calculate the clock period used in this simulation. Then, find the … WebApr 11, 2024 · 基于vivado(语言Verilog)的FPGA学习(5)——跨时钟处理. 1. 为什么要解决跨时钟处理问题. 慢时钟到快时钟一般都不需要处理,关键需要解决从快时钟到慢时钟 … WebApr 6, 2024 · 思路:. 1.每个输入的数据d都要依次输出4个乘法结果,考虑用状态机实现四个状态S0,S1,S2,S3;. 2.每个输入的数据长度不一样,为保证输出结果不因d的变化而错误,考虑寄存信号d; 3.在S0状态寄存信号d时,若采用非阻塞赋值会导致状态S0无法输出正确结 … hornungs spectator seat stick

基于vivado(语言Verilog)的FPGA学习(5)——跨时钟 …

Category:基于vivado(语言Verilog)的FPGA学习(5)——跨时钟处理_小 …

Tags:Clk in testbench verilog

Clk in testbench verilog

Verilog Testbench - wait for specific number of clock cycle edges

Web9.3. Testbench with ‘initial block’¶ Note that, testbenches are written in separate Verilog files as shown in Listing 9.2. Simplest way to write a testbench, is to invoke the ‘design for testing’ in the testbench and … WebApr 10, 2024 · From my knowledge, this is not recommended, for two reasons: 1. If the driver has a bug, then the design and the scoreboard will get two different versions of supposedly the same input. 2. If this testbench were to be integrated at a higher level environment, then the scoreboard would not work - in such higher level env, the decoder …

Clk in testbench verilog

Did you know?

WebIf the RTL is in verilog, the Clock generator is written in Verilog even if the TestBench is written in other languages like Vera, Specman or SystemC. Clock can be generated … WebAug 16, 2024 · The verilog code below shows how the clock and the reset signals are generated in our testbench. // generate the clock initial begin clk = 1'b0; forever #1 clk = …

http://www.testbench.in/TB_08_CLOCK_GENERATOR.html Web//Below Block is used to generate expected outputs in Test bench only. These outputs //are used to compare with DUT output. You have Checker task (ScoreBoard in SV), for //that you need Reference output ... Verilog …

http://testbench.in/verilog_basic_examples.html WebJan 29, 2024 · always@ (clk) begin clk = 1; #20; clk = 0; #20; end. It will only run when clk is high, since you have @ (clk) as the sensitivity list at the beginning of the block. A more …

WebSep 12, 2024 · In my testbench, I want to wait for two events in sequence: one after 60000 clock cycles and next after additional 5000 clock cycles. I know I can wait for clock edges …

Webtestbench, add_two_values_tb.v, and verify the functionality. 1-1-1. Open Vivado and create a blank project called lab4_1_1. 1-1-2. Create and add the Verilog module, … hornungs rental harrisburg paWebMar 3, 2024 · Here's a quick course on procedural code in Verilog: always statement; is an instantiation of a procedural process that begins at time 0, and when that statement … hornungs linglestown paWebMar 31, 2024 · Hence, we can write the code for operation of the clock in a testbench as: module always_block_example; reg clk; initial begin clk = … hornung statsWebThe Verilog test bench module cnt16_tb.v is found in Appendix B. Notice that there are no ports listed in the module. This is because all stimulus applied to the DUT is ... example, … hornungs hardware harrisburg paWebAug 26, 2024 · Don't mix <= and = in a single always block. Though I have never done this way yet, I can think of that on the 2nd active clock edge after in_1's deassertion, out is updated to the new counter which has … hornungs rentals linglestown pahttp://testbench.in/verilog_basic_examples.html hornung\\u0027s guessWebVS Code丰富的插件可以加快verilog书写速度,提高电路设计效率。 效果演示:分别演示了moudle、always块 快速书写(下文含配置方法及本人配置代码);文档自动生成、电路图生成、自动例化和tb生成(电路图生成十分… hornungs true value halifax pa